Members of two football supporters' groups caused panic in Barreiro on Sunday night after violent clashes. The Barreirense and Olímpico do Montijo supporters engaged in mutual attacks in the street, using pyrotechnic devices. Everything was captured on amateur footage. The match between the two teams had no police presence and, by the time the PSP (Public Security Police) arrived, those involved had already dispersed.

The Analysis Report on Violence Associated with Sport combines data from the PNID and APCVD. Use of pyrotechnic devices remains the most common type of incident.

Overall violence at sporting events has fallen, but the use of pyrotechnics (flares/fireworks) continues, with football responsible for the vast majority of incidents.
